Sunk Loto are back in full force, and the Gold Coast heavyweights sound nowhere near ready to slow down after nearly three decades of riffs and reinvention.
The Australian metal pioneers have unveiled their new single ‘Dead Shadows’, alongside the band’s first official music video featuring members of the group since 2003, this follows 2024’s ‘God Complex’. The new track feels less like a nostalgia grab and more like a band ripping open the next chapter, it’s produced alongside revered heavy music architect Forrester Savell, ‘Dead Shadows’ leans into the thick, humid groove that made Sunk Loto one of Australia’s defining alternative metal acts, while still pushing their sound into rougher and more atmospheric territory.

Following the Between Birth and Death 20 year anniversary tour in late 2023, we got back together early in 2024 with a handful of ideas that quickly turned into four new tracks, including Dead Shadows,’ the band shared.
‘We headed into the studio with Forrester Savell to bring them to life soon after.’
The band added: ‘Dead Shadows felt like the right first single after a few years away, it sits right in that space between where we’ve come from and where we’re heading, and it really lets Jas’ vocals shine.’
That balance is probably what makes the track hit hardest, it still carries the bruised swagger and downtuned stomp longtime fans expect, but there’s also a sharper sense of control running beneath it, Jason Brown’s vocals cut through with more weight than ever.
For older Australian heavy music fans, Sunk Loto’s legacy hardly needs rehashing, from signing with Sony as teenagers to sharing stages with global heavyweights during the late ’90s and early 2000s boom, the band helped define an era where Australian alternative metal briefly felt unstoppable.
Now, after reuniting in 2022 and rebuilding momentum through sold out tours and new material, Sunk Loto seem determined to prove this revival isn’t temporary.
The band will return to the stage this August for three already sold out east coast shows in Brisbane, Sydney, and Melbourne.
